New SAE ratings are irrelevant concerning the lightning, since it is rated under the old system as well. Under the old system, the '03 TL-S is rated at 260 hp and 232 ft.-lbs. of torque pulling around 3558 lbs.; the '04 Lightning is rated at 380 hp and 450 ft.-lbs of torque ( ) pulling around 4670 lbs.

Using a 1/4 mile calculator I found on the web, 3558 lbs and 260 hp gives 13.9 sec. 4650 lbs and 380 hp gives 13.4 sec.
Using the same calculator, you'd need upwards of 290 hp on a TL, plus some way to get it really hooked up on the launch, to have a chance against a stock Lightning.
